Evolution AB is a Swedish company and the world's leading developer and supplier of live casino solutions for online gaming operators. Founded in 2006 and headquartered in Stockholm, it produces live dealer games - including roulette, blackjack and a range of game shows - streamed from studios across Europe, the Americas and Asia. Through the acquisitions of NetEnt, Red Tiger, Big Time Gaming and others, the group is also a major online slots provider. Listed on Nasdaq Stockholm, Evolution employs more than 20,000 people worldwide.
